Output dbc8d99e91bbe42423c1af722ac84adf75491147dc9e76bbbeea44bbf2a74666:0

value
1000035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86f751580acba09c65d980205dbe6c61e92de0c8 OP_EQUAL
address
3DzekBq7KQiot8LbFwQtLpjTyyGBi6BZwd
transaction
dbc8d99e91bbe42423c1af722ac84adf75491147dc9e76bbbeea44bbf2a74666
spent
true